CSS样式冲突:如何精准选择内部h3标签避免全局样式影响?

CSS样式冲突:如何精准选择内部h3标签避免全局样式影响?

巧妙解决css样式冲突:精准定位内部h3标签

在维护老旧项目时,经常会遇到全局CSS样式与局部样式冲突的问题。例如,全局样式定义了h3标签的样式,而文章内容(位于id为ac_content的div内)中的h3标签需要不同的样式。如何避免全局样式影响文章内容,又不修改全局样式呢?

关键在于使用精准的选择器,只针对文章内容内的h3标签进行样式覆盖。 我们可以利用CSS的:not伪类选择器来实现这个目标。:not选择器可以排除特定元素,从而避免样式冲突。

解决方案:

使用以下CSS代码,即可精准选择ac_content外部的h3标签,并对其应用样式:

立即学习“前端免费学习笔记(深入)”;

h3:not(#ac_content h3) {  /*  在此处添加您想要覆盖的样式  */}

登录后复制

本文来自互联网或AI生成,不代表软件指南立场。本站不负任何法律责任。

如若转载请注明出处:http://www.down96.com/tutorials/12648.html

热心网友热心网友
上一篇 2025-04-11 17:04
下一篇 2025-04-11 17:04

相关推荐

本站[软件指南]所有内容来自互联网投稿或AI智能生成,并不代表软件指南的立场。